Fact:  There are more than 200 species of owls in the world, which are divided into 2 main groups: owls and barn owls. Owls usually have a round face, a short tail and a large head. A barnish face has a heart-shaped, long paws and strong claws. The colors prevailing in the plumage of these birds, mainly shades of brown, rust, gray, white, black, form patterns - this helps the owl to be invisible to its own prey. (Tattoo by Teresa Sharpe)

Owls are predators; they feed on small mammals, such as mice, squirrels and rabbits. Since they have no teeth, they either tear their prey into small pieces, or swallow it whole. (Ghost Owl. Written by Teresa Sharpe

Fact: Many species of owls are designed so that they produce less sound when flying, which makes it easier for them to hunt. All this is due to the structure of their feathers. Special elastic and porous tips of feathers on the rear edge of the owl's wings are able to absorb and suppress most of the sound vibrations that occur during flight. Suuuper! Dark cult of the night bird

An owl is a bird of prey that hunts at night. Many occult practices are associated with the worship of this animal, personifying the mystery of the night. Owls are a reflection of loneliness, sadness and death. As you can see, the owl is a very ambiguous symbol.

In the customs of many nations, one can observe the worship of this animal, reverence for the wisdom and mystery of the night. Owl many associate with witchcraft, and this is not in vain. Evil spirits and witches are characters that are inextricably linked with owls. Birds are often found in folk superstitions as harbingers of something bad. Perhaps that is why the owl to this day remains a demonic dark symbol.

Dive into the past. In ancient Rome, the cry of an owl was a harbinger of misfortune. In medieval Europe, Christians believed that an owl is a reincarnated witch flying on a sabbath. The Celts called the animal a dead bird, which clearly underlines the dark side of this symbol. Interestingly, many Asian and African nations depicted an owl on funeral attributes, which also causes very clear associations.

Why does an owl have such dark fame? This is due to primitive animal fear, which arose in a man when he met a bird with burning eyes, uttering the cry of the grave in the night silence. The owl, suddenly appearing from mourning darkness, left a depressing impression. And so the glory of the ominous messenger of bad news was fixed to the owl for long millennia.

However, the image of the bird is multifaceted and not so straightforward. In many cultures, this animal is perceived fundamentally differently. Let's open the other side of the coin.

Wisdom and composure

An owl as a symbol can be viewed from a different angle. It is no secret that in folklore owls have always been the personification of life experience and erudition. At the same time, the bird as a symbol reflects not so much the careless pursuit of knowledge, as the cold mind and insight of a predator.

The owl is the constant companion of Athena - the goddess, who among the ancient Greeks was the patroness of wisdom. Athena was depicted on silver coins along with a bird of the night.

Why did the ancient Greeks like this bird so much? Everything is very simple. Observing the owl’s way of life, the Greeks discovered its resemblance to the lonely philosopher’s way of life. And the magnificent sight, which allows the birds to see in the dark, was perceived as insight. Since then, the owl is a symbol of understanding the essence of things.

Owl as a symbol is also associated with such a mysterious phenomenon as a dream. The significance of the owl tattoo can also be associated with astral or psychedelic travels.
